Reply by Moneyman/TX on 11/25/10 3:56pm Msg #362765
They aren't asking for your blood type?
My thoughts: W9 = OK Their test = OK BGC = Maybe. If you want to, but I would not submit to one via any "one" SS company. And after the mess with XYZ, they will not get my money for one either. JMO DL = Only with sensitive info blacked out SS = No, not in your case
$25 = No way! I don't pay any SS company to place my name on their roster. They do not guarantee any signings. Basically they want you to pay to advertise (place your name on their roster) to one company. Not to mention it is just another stream of income for them. When I find a SS willing to guarantee me $150-200 per signing, x number of loans per month, and pay True Net 30 then I'll pay $25 to "sign up" with them.
